The Supreme Court has indicated it generally does not intervene in rejected nomination cases before elections. Candidates usually seek remedies through election law after rejection. The court questioned if it had ever interfered at this nomination scrutiny stage. This stance was taken while hearing a Congress leader's plea against her nomination rejection for Rajya Sabha polls in Madhya Pradesh.
